
拓海先生、最近部下から「構造化スパース学習」という論文が業務改善に効くと聞いて、何やら難しそうでして。要点を教えていただけますか。

素晴らしい着眼点ですね!大丈夫、順を追って説明しますよ。端的に言えば、この研究は「変数間の関係を使って、多くの候補の中から意味ある要素だけを効率的に選ぶ方法」を速く安定に解けるようにした技術です。まずはなぜその必要があるかを整理しましょう。

なるほど。社内で言えば、たくさんの設備データや取引情報がありまして、どれが本当に効く指標か分からないのです。従来の手法では単純に重要度の高いものを抜き出すと聞きましたが、それだけでは不十分でしょうか。

素晴らしい着眼点ですね!その通りです。従来のℓ1正則化(L1 regularization、通称ラッソ)は個々の要素を選ぶ力はあるのですが、設備同士の関係やグループ構造を無視してしまいます。ここでのポイントは「構造を組み込むとより実務的に意味のある選択ができる」ことです。

構造を組み込むとどう現場で役立つのですか。例えば、似た測定値が複数ある場合にまとめて扱えるとかでしょうか。

素晴らしい着眼点ですね!まさにその通りです。言い換えると、関連する指標をグループ化して「グループ単位で選ぶ」や「近い値同士を揃える」といった条件をモデルに組み込めます。これにより解釈性が高まり、実務での意思決定に直結しやすくなるんです。

しかし先生、そうした構造を入れると計算がすごく重くなると聞きます。我々のような中堅企業が運用するには現実的でしょうか。

素晴らしい着眼点ですね!ここがこの論文の肝です。提案法は「スムージング」と呼ぶ近似で非分離な罰則項を扱いやすく変換し、その上で近接勾配(proximal gradient)という高速な反復法を使います。結果として従来の遅い手法に比べて桁違いにスケーラブルになりますよ。

これって要するに、複雑なルールを「扱いやすい形」に丸めて、速い反復で解くということですか?

素晴らしい着眼点ですね!まさに要するにその通りです。専門用語で言えば、非分離(non-separable)な構造罰則を滑らかな近似に置き換え、効率的な一階法で解くことにより、収束速度と計算量を両立させています。ポイントは実装が比較的簡単で現場導入が現実的な点です。

現場導入の際に抑えるべきポイントは何でしょうか。コストや人材の面で注意点があれば教えてください。

素晴らしい着眼点ですね!要点を3つにまとめます。1) ドメイン知識で意味あるグループやグラフを定義すること、2) スムージングの強さなどハイパーパラメータ調整の工夫、3) 実データでの検証と解釈のプロセスの確立です。これらを押さえればROIは十分に見込めますよ。

よく分かりました。では私なりに言い直します。複雑な選別ルールを計算しやすい形に滑らかにして、速く安定に解けるようにすることで、実務的に意味ある指標の抽出が現実的になる、という理解で合っていますでしょうか。

その通りです。素晴らしい着眼点ですね!まさにその理解で十分に実務へ活かせますよ。大丈夫、一緒に少しずつ進めれば必ずできますから。
1.概要と位置づけ
本論文は、高次元回帰問題に対して、変数間の既知の構造情報を罰則項として組み込む「構造化スパース(structured sparsity)」の最適化問題を、実務で使える速度と精度で解くための手法を提案するものである。結論を先に述べると、この研究は「非分離な構造罰則を滑らかに近似し、高速な近接勾配法で効率的に解く」というアイデアにより、従来法よりも計算効率とスケーラビリティを両立させた点で大きく進歩した。基礎的には変数選択の枠組みを拡張するものであり、応用的には多数のセンサーや説明変数が存在する現場で、意味のある特徴群を抜き出す実務的手段となる。
従来、単純なℓ1正則化(L1 regularization、通称ラッソ)は個々の特徴を選ぶ力がある一方で、変数間の構造を反映することは苦手であった。そこで複数の変数を一つのグループとして扱う「グループラッソ(group lasso)」や、隣接する変数の値を揃える「グラフ誘導融合(graph-guided fusion)」のような罰則が提案されてきた。しかしこれらは罰則が非分離であるため、最適化が難しく計算コストが膨らみがちであった。本研究はその主要な障壁を解消した点に位置づけられる。
本手法の中心は二つある。一つはNesterov流のスムージング技術で非分離な罰則を扱いやすく近似すること、もう一つは近接勾配(proximal gradient)という一階法を適用することで反復毎の計算を軽くすることである。これにより理論的な収束保証を保ちながら、現実的なデータサイズでの運用を可能にしている。要するに数理的な工夫によって現場での計算負荷を抑えたのだ。
ビジネスの比喩で言うなら、膨大な候補から有望な複数の製品群を見つけ出す作業を、単品ごとに検討するのではなく、関連する候補をまとまりとして評価することで意思決定を高速化する仕組みである。これにより解釈性が高まり、導入後の現場での説明責任も果たしやすくなる。
以上の点から、本研究はアルゴリズム設計の観点で学術的価値を持ち、同時に実務での導入可能性という観点でも重要である。特に多数のセンサーデータや部品データを扱う製造業や保守領域で即効性のある手法になり得るという点を強調しておきたい。
2.先行研究との差別化ポイント
先行研究では、構造化スパースを扱うためにさまざまな個別手法が提案されてきた。例えば、重複するグループを許すオーバーラップ群ラッソや、グラフ構造に基づいて変数間の差を抑える融合罰則などである。これらは特定のクラスの問題で有効だが、一般的な非分離罰則群をまとめて扱う汎用的手法には乏しかった。
本論文の差別化は、これら一見異なる罰則を共通の形に落とし込み、同一の最適化枠組みで扱えるようにした点にある。具体的には、罰則項の双対ノルム(dual norm)を利用して非分離部分を分離可能な形へ変換し、スムージングを施すことで一階法が使えるようにしている。結果として個別手法ごとの煩雑なアルゴリズム設計を避けられる。
また、計算効率の面でも差が出る。従来は内点法などの二階情報を必要とする手法や、単純なサブグラディエント法では収束速度やスケーラビリティに限界があった。提案法は理論上の収束率が良好で、しかも反復ごとの計算が軽いため、大規模データでも実行可能である点が実務寄りだ。
さらに、マルチタスク学習への拡張が自然に行える点も差別化ポイントである。出力側にも構造がある場合に、その構造をそのまま罰則へ組み込めるため、複数の関連タスクを同時に学習する場面で有利に働く。これは製造現場で複数機種を同時に分析する際に特に有用である。
結論として、差別化は「一般性」「計算効率」「マルチタスク適用性」の三点に集約できる。これにより研究は学術的な意義と実務上の実用性を両立している。
3.中核となる技術的要素
技術的には三つの要素が中核を成す。第一は非分離罰則を扱うための双対ノルム変換であり、これにより複雑な罰則項を最小化可能な形式へ変形できる点である。第二はNesterovのスムージングという手法で、原問題の非滑らかな罰則を滑らかな近似で置き換えることにより一階法の適用を可能にする点だ。第三は近接勾配法(proximal gradient method)で、滑らか化された問題に対して効率的に反復計算を進める。
双対ノルムの考え方を噛み砕くと、複雑なルールを外から眺めて「このルールを満たす限界を測る尺度」を作る操作である。これにより元の罰則が持つ相互依存性を分解できるため、計算上の分離が実現する。ビジネス的に言えば、複雑な業務ルールをいくつかの検査基準に分解して評価可能にする作業に相当する。
スムージングは、角張った問題を少し丸めて解きやすくする処置と考えればよい。丸めすぎると元の意図が失われるが、適度に丸めれば解の精度を保ちながら計算を大幅に軽くできる。近接勾配法はこの丸めた問題に対して、各反復で簡単な更新を繰り返すだけで解を逼近する効率的な手法である。
これらを組み合わせることで、罰則の種類に依存せず一貫した実装が可能になり、パラメータ調整や検証の手間も削減できる。実装面では既存の最適化ライブラリと組み合わせやすく、現場のデータサイエンティストが扱いやすい点も実用性に寄与する。
以上を踏まえると、技術の本質は「複雑性の管理」と「計算の効率化」にある。これらは現場導入におけるボトルネックを直接的に解消する性質を持つため、事業投資としての魅力が高い。
4.有効性の検証方法と成果
論文では数値実験を通じて、提案法が従来法に比べて計算時間、収束速度、そしてスケーラビリティの面で優れることを示している。具体的には、合成データと実データの両方を用い、オーバーラップ群ラッソやグラフ誘導融合といった代表的罰則に対して比較評価を行っている。実験結果は理論的な主張と整合しており、スムージングのパラメータを適切に設定すれば高い精度を維持したまま計算コストを削減できる。
評価指標としては、推定誤差と選択された特徴の妥当性、さらに反復当たりの計算量や総計算時間が用いられている。これらの指標で提案法は従来の内点法や単純なサブグラディエント法に対して一貫して優れた結果を示した。特に大規模な次元数のケースでその優位性が顕著である。
また、マルチタスク設定においても同様の有効性が示されている。複数の出力が関連している状況では、出力間の構造を罰則に組み込むことで性能が向上することが確認されており、製造や保守の実務的ユースケースで有望である。これにより一度に複数の関連する予測課題を処理できるメリットがある。
ただし、検証は論文執筆時点のデータセットや条件に依存するため、導入に際しては自社データでの再評価が必須である。特にスムージング強度や正則化パラメータはデータ特性に大きく依存するため、検証計画をしっかり立てる必要がある。
総じて、論文の実験は提案法の有効性を十分に裏付けている。実務導入を検討する際は、小規模なパイロットから始め、パラメータ調整と解釈性のチェックを繰り返すことが成功の鍵である。
5.研究を巡る議論と課題
この手法は多くの利点をもつ一方で、いくつかの課題も残る。第一にスムージングの度合いの選択である。滑らかにしすぎると元の構造的性質が失われる可能性があり、逆に滑らかさを抑えると計算上の利点が薄れる。適切なトレードオフをデータに応じて見つける必要がある。
第二に、構造の定義そのものが現場知識に依存する点だ。グループ分けやグラフ構造を間違えるとモデルの説明力が落ちるため、ドメインエキスパートとの協働が不可欠である。加えて、自動的に構造を学ぶ手法と組み合わせる試みが今後の課題として残る。
第三に、大規模な実運用での安定したハイパーパラメータ調整ワークフローの確立が必要だ。実務では複数の現場要件や検証基準が存在するため、単純なクロスバリデーションだけで済まない場合もある。これらに対する実践的なガイドライン作りが求められる。
最後に、解釈性の担保である。構造を導入することで解釈性は向上するが、滑らかな近似を経ることで微妙な差分が生じる可能性がある。したがって、可視化や要因分解の手法を併用して意思決定者へ分かりやすく提示する仕組みが重要になる。
以上を踏まえると、研究は理論と初期実験での有望性を示したが、現場適用のためにはドメイン知識の反映、ハイパーパラメータ運用、解釈性の補強といった実務的な課題への対処が今後の重要な論点である。
6.今後の調査・学習の方向性
今後の研究と現場導入の方向性としては三点を提案する。第一に、自動的に構造を推定するメタ学習的手法との連携である。現場で構造を一から設計する負担を減らすことで、導入の敷居が下がる。第二に、オンライン環境やストリーミングデータに適用する拡張である。生産ラインの連続データに対して逐次的に学習し更新する能力は実務で価値が高い。
第三に、可視化と説明可能性のためのツール群の整備である。経営判断に使うためには単にモデル出力を示すだけでなく、なぜその特徴群が選ばれたのかを示す説明が必要だ。これには因果推論や部分依存プロットのような補助手法の統合が有用である。
教育面では、データサイエンティストとドメインエキスパートが共同で使える実務向けのワークフローの設計が求められる。小さなパイロットから始め、継続的にハイパーパラメータと構造定義を改善していく運用プロセスを作ることが重要だ。
最後に、産業横断的なベンチマークとベストプラクティスの共有により技術の普及が促進されるだろう。製造、保守、ヘルスケアなど複数領域での事例集が整えば、導入の不確実性が低減しROIの見積もりもやりやすくなる。
これらを進めることで、理論上の優位性が実務での確かな価値へと結びつく。まずは小規模実証から始めて、段階的にスケールさせる方針を推奨する。
検索用キーワード(英語)
structured sparsity, smoothing proximal gradient, overlapping group lasso, graph-guided fusion, convex optimization, multi-task learning
会議で使えるフレーズ集
「この手法は関連する指標をグループ単位で選べるので、解釈性を損なわずに変数選択が可能です。」
「まずはパイロットでスムージングと正則化の感度を確認し、ROIを見てからスケールします。」
「現場のドメイン知識を使って意味あるグループ定義を行えば、導入効果がより明確になります。」


